Transaction 72c8ee2f969e3a8b39b327a3327e8468893ee600f9b7bb9791876b2ae7f3a81f

4 Input
2 Outputs
  • 72c8ee2f969e3a8b39b327a3327e8468893ee600f9b7bb9791876b2ae7f3a81f:0
  • value  2140000000
    address  39riecueJReo3PnqPX6PSctxtGzTt372LY
  • 72c8ee2f969e3a8b39b327a3327e8468893ee600f9b7bb9791876b2ae7f3a81f:1
  • value  395605
    address  17JdSFTzHcTPfUdV1jhUwetJndnWsEmE7A